Job description:

Our wireless tech is responsible for installing, maintaining, and troubleshooting wireless networks and systems. They are skilled in working with various DAS systems, coax and antenna infrastructure, and fiber optic networks, and they use hand tools and software tools as required. In addition, they may perform walk testing for in-building coverage. Their expertise ensures seamless 4G and 5G coverage wherever wireless customers are.
